PROBLEM DESCRIPTION
Many stations & data to store. Data can be fregmented into little units (packets) and sent to
stations. When balancing load, some problems occur.

problems

solutions of modern algorithms

Which station to choose for a packet?

Basing on info collected from stations or by
uniformly distributed random algorithms.

How to send a packet to a station?

IP address database, centralized
solutions, distributed ip tables.

How to retireve a packet? How to locate
the station it is stored in?

Need to memorize couple (packet-id,
station-id) after choosing dst station.

How to balance packets among
different stations?

Round-robin (stateless) approaches or
basing on station loads.

WHAT ABOUT THE OTHERS?

つづく

Load balancing is a known field in literature. Common practices exist.
A typical architecture is centralizing load balancing into a
single network component responsible for that task.
The Load Balancer typically knows everything about all
stations. Its task is to open connections on stations
upon requests. The decision is selecting a station to
open a connection to.
Very often, common architectures like Cysco and IBM,
organize servers in clusters and pools to handle group
configurations.
The balancer is not physically connected to stations.
Everything is done through TCP/IP and a list of IPs is kept.
In any case, the balancer has a complete knowledge.

KEY CONCEPT: DIRECT ADDRESSING
When assigning a station to a packet, the system will not save data about this association
anywhere. At retrieval, given the packet-id, the station must be located immediately.
On packet forwarding: destination station is
computed but not memorized anywhere. The
packet will be stored at the corresponding
station with no further overhead.
On packet retrieval: destination station is
computed without relying on other info.
Destination station is reached and packet
correctly fetched.

KEY CONCEPT: STATELESS BALANCING
To balance data-load on stations, no info is required from stations. The packet is assigned with
a station without any further operation.
Data load balancing does not require
data from stations prior to station
assignment or in any further moment.
Stations keep (almost) the same
amount of packets all the time.
No overhead is generated on the
network and in time evaluations when
balancing data-loads.

NOT A FIELD OF DAISES
There are many problems to solve. In particular, accurate simulations are needed.
Good simulations should try to emulate real scenarions with hundreds of thousands
of packets => big loads sent to stations and many more stations => big station pools.
Current developed simulations are slow (Mathworks Matlab, Wolfram
Mathematica). Mathematical environments + functional languages cannot provide
good performance. Need for better simulations => parallelization is possible!
Numerical problems on the way. Need for numerical methods => Need for good
and fast libraries!
Parallelization would definitely fasten simulations. Need for coded simulations =>
C/C++: good performance. Parallelization libraries + good performance:
architecture dependent parallel libraries.
